Investigation of the Uptake and Transport of Aspirin Eugenol Ester in the Caco-2 Cell Model

Abstract: Background: Aspirin eugenol ester (AEE) is a novel medicinal compound synthesized by esterification of aspirin with eugenol using the prodrug principle. AEE has the pharmacological activities of being anti-inflammatory, antipyretic, analgesic, anti-cardiovascular diseases, and anti-oxidative stress However, its oral bioavailability is poor, and its intestinal absorption and transport characteristics are still unknown.Objective: The purpose of this study was to investigate the uptake and transport mechanisms of… Show more

“…Caco-2 cells in the logarithmic growth phase were seeded onto 24well polyester clear Transwell ® inserts with a membrane area of 0.33 cm 2 and a pore size of 0.4 μm at a density of 10 5 cells/cm 2 per well (Wen et al, 2021;Tao et al, 2022). Apical (AP) and basolateral (BL) compartments of the transport plate were filled with 0.2 mL and 1 mL of liquid, respectively.…”
